Output e3ef50b7cdc5aa659aec01d8fde3e98e24bce6e0f67e6c567e5f106e38ea46b7:33

value
2494160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a04b06409c2867fec25225a657d628d23e518ba OP_EQUAL
address
3HBzQxJAc8q2gzUP5gzFoFNjWRLmudXrAP
transaction
e3ef50b7cdc5aa659aec01d8fde3e98e24bce6e0f67e6c567e5f106e38ea46b7
confirmations
425242
spent
true